In spite of Bill O’Reilly’s rhetoric, homeless veterans exist, they’re in our backyards and Project HOME and the city of Philadelphia are doing something about it. Thanks to some stimulus cash, Project HOME and the city are renovating a 54-unit apartment building in Tioga specifically for homeless veterans. It’s at 2101 W. Verango Street. And Your Nutt’s...
